Transaction 7620ddefb89d138868f7b9c9452f80d9041dcf2a20616ab0cdf2f7bd4630b683
1 Input
2 Outputs
- 7620ddefb89d138868f7b9c9452f80d9041dcf2a20616ab0cdf2f7bd4630b683:0
- 7620ddefb89d138868f7b9c9452f80d9041dcf2a20616ab0cdf2f7bd4630b683:1
value 475000
address 14wYgd4scVskUFoQsK6ZrgVKHu3pchxaFE
value 589108033
address 115mTVEF9SisoaPsxXEjyPPS6yJiTZsWCA